What are the REAL ID requirements at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office?
To obtain a REAL ID at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office, you will need to provide proof of identity, Social Security number, and Illinois residency. The required documents include a valid passport, birth certificate, or other approved identification, as well as a Social Security card or W-2 form, and two documents showing your Illinois address, such as a utility bill or lease agreement.
How do I transfer my out-of-state license to Illinois at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office?
To transfer your out-of-state license to Illinois at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office, you will need to provide your out-of-state license, proof of identity, and proof of Illinois residency. You will also need to pass a vision test and pay the required fee for a new Illinois driver's license.

What is the process for renewing my driver's license at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office?
To renew your driver's license at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office, you will need to provide your current license, proof of identity, and proof of Illinois residency. You will also need to pass a vision test and pay the required renewal fee. You can renew your license in person at the office or by mail, if eligible.
How do I update my address on my driver's license at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office?
To update your address on your driver's license at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office, you will need to provide proof of your new address, such as a utility bill or lease agreement, and your current driver's license. You can visit the office in person and fill out the required form to update your address.

How do I register and title my vehicle at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office?
To register and title your vehicle at the Lincoln Secretary of State Office, you will need to provide the vehicle's title, proof of insurance, and proof of identity. You will also need to pay the required registration and title fees. You can visit the office in person and fill out the required forms to register and title your vehicle.
